Head-to-head: Bakhmutkina 1 - 1 Hageman
They have played 6 sets in total, with Polina Bakhmutkina winning 3 and Madelief Hageman winning 3. The last match between Polina Bakhmutkina and Madelief Hageman was at the W15 Oegstgeest, 01-05-2025, Round: R2, Surface: Clay, with Madelief Hageman getting the victory 7-6(3) 5-7 7-6(2).
